What is sacred?

A church or mosque with walls that hold space for us
to be still in our moments of thanksgiving and supplication?
A face or body of a loved one
that brings joy to our hearts simply at their appearance in our moments?
A vision of the Mother holding our brothers and sisters
nurturing them 'til their death?
The land that gives crops to feed a family,
a crop deemed deadly to those who consume it?
A country that expels a monk
because he teaches a philosophy of peace?
The ruins of our ancestors telling stories of their journey
here in the space in which we walk?
Hunger that kills our children
when the rains don't pour to bring the maize to us?
The kiss of a child, gaze of a lover,
embrace from a friend?
The rivers that run our souls to the oceans
to evaporate to the spirit world?
The loss of the life path we have walked with security?

Sacred�all sacred and of One

The winds of time~~sacred in their kiss
Sends each of these gifts
Of living
And death

Our Prayer, giver of life and death,
Is that we understand the sacredness
Of each of your gifts to us
